Transaction 085df88f957ca0f3487247c8ef68bc607600c35620d644383b3f73123ee82b30

12 Input
1 Outputs
  • 085df88f957ca0f3487247c8ef68bc607600c35620d644383b3f73123ee82b30:0
  • value  1197592
    address  1AveDxJzZMwpbduQser5eAzuF53DABmCMr